Solaris 10 新增功能

檔案系統增強功能

本節旨在說明 Solaris 10 3/05 發行版本中的所有檔案系統,哪些部分是新增功能,哪些則是增強 2002 年 5 月所發行之 Solaris 9 作業系統的原有功能。

NFS 版本 4

這是 Software Express 試驗程式中的新增功能。在 Solaris Express 8/04 發行版本中,NFS 版本 4 已成為預設功能。Solaris 10 3/05 發行版本中有此功能。

Solaris 10 作業系統包含 Sun 的 NFS 版本 4 分散式檔案存取通訊協定實作。此版本是 NFS 改良過程中的下一個邏輯階段。NFS 版本 4 通訊協定詳載於 RFC 3530,是在網際網路工程任務推動小組 (IETF) 的支援下所建立的。供應商及作業系統雙方皆不主導此版本的設計。

NFS 版本 4 整合了檔案存取、檔案鎖定,整併各種通訊協定為可輕鬆通過防火牆的單一、統一的通訊協定,並且增強了安全性防護。NFS 版本 4 的 Solaris 實作完全整合了 Kerberos V5 (亦稱為 SEAM),以提供驗證、完整性及私密性。NFS 版本 4 也會協調用戶端和伺服器之間使用的安全性類別。透過 NFS 版本 4,伺服器可以針對不同的檔案系統提供不同的安全性類別。

NFS 版本 4 的 Solaris 實作包括委派作業,這是一種伺服器用來將檔案管理之權委派給用戶端的技術。此技術可以減少來回往返作業的次數,因為用戶端得到保證,若是伺服器沒有通知用戶端便不會發生任何修改行為。此通訊協定也包含作業複合,其允許多重作業結合為單一「over-the-wire」要求。

如需有關 NFS 版本 4 的更多資訊,請參閱「System Administration Guide: Network Services」中的第 6 章「Accessing Network File Systems (Reference)」。

UFS 記錄預設為已啟用

這是 Solaris Express 4/04 發行版本與 Solaris 9 9/04 發行版本中的新增功能。

依預設,記錄現在已經在所有 UFS 檔案系統中啟用,但以下情況除外:

在先前的 Solaris 發行版本中,您必須手動啟用 UFS 記錄。

UFS 記錄將構成完整 UFS 作業的多重中介資料變更封裝至一個作業事件中。作業事件集會記錄在磁碟記錄中,接著會套用至實際 UFS 檔案系統的中介資料中。

UFS 記錄提供了兩個優點:

如需更多資訊,請參閱「System Administration Guide: Devices and File Systems」中的「What’s New in File Systems in the Solaris 10 Release?」。另請參閱「mount_ufs(1M) 線上手冊」。

NFS 用戶端的增強功能

這是 Software Express 試驗程式與 Solaris 9 12/03 發行版本中的新增功能。Solaris 10 3/05 發行版本中有此功能。

以下增強功能提升了 NFS 用戶端的效能:

如需進一步資訊,請參閱「System Administration Guide: Network Services」

多 TB UFS 檔案系統

多 TB UFS 檔案系統支援只適用於執行 64 位元核心的系統。這是 Software Express 試驗程式與 Solaris 9 8/03 發行版本中的新增功能。Solaris 10 3/05 發行版本中有此功能。

Solaris 10 作業系統在執行 64 位元 Solaris 核心的系統上,支援多 TB UFS 檔案系統。以前,在 64 位元系統和 32 位元系統上,UFS 檔案系統均被限制在大約 1 兆位元組 (TB) 內。所有 UFS 檔案系統指令和公用程式均已更新,以支援多 TB UFS 檔案系統。

您可以先建立一個小於 1 TB 的 UFS 檔案系統。使用 newfs -T 指令,您可以指定將該檔案系統最終擴展到多 TB 檔案系統。此指令可設定 I 節點和分段密度,以為多 TB 檔案系統進行適當的比例調整。

對多 TB UFS 檔案系統的支援假定多 TB LUN 可用。這些 LUN 被提供做為 Solaris Volume Manager 的磁碟區,或做為大於 1 TB 的實體磁碟。

多 TB UFS 檔案系統包含以下功能:

多 TB UFS 檔案系統包含以下限制:

如需更多資訊,請參閱「System Administration Guide: Devices and File Systems」中的「What's New in File Systems in the Solaris 10 Release?」。

裝置檔案系統 (devfs)

這是 Software Express 試驗程式中的新增功能。Solaris 10 3/05 發行版本中有此功能。

devfs 檔案系統可在 Software Express 發行版本中管理裝置。使用者可透過 /dev 目錄中的項目持續存取所有裝置。這些項目是以符號連結到 /devices 目錄中的項目。/devices 目錄的內容現在是由 devfs 檔案系統所控制。/devices 目錄中的項目會動態顯示目前系統上可存取裝置的狀態。這些項目不需要管理。

devfs 檔案系統提供下列增強功能:

如需更多資訊,請參閱「devfs(7FS) 線上手冊」。

使用 EFI 磁碟標籤的多 TB 磁碟支援

多 TB 磁碟支援只適用於執行 64 位元核心的系統。這是 Software Express 試驗程式與 Solaris 9 4/03 發行版本中的新增功能。Solaris 10 3/05 發行版本中有此功能。

Solaris 10 作業系統在執行 64 位元 Solaris 核心的系統上,支援大於 1 兆位元組 (TB) 的磁碟。

可延伸式韌體介面 (EFI) 標籤可提供實體磁碟與虛擬磁碟磁碟區支援。UFS 檔案系統與 EFI 磁碟標籤相容,並且您可以建立大於 1 TB 的 UFS 檔案系統。此發行版本還包括更新的用於管理大於 1 TB 磁碟的磁碟公用程式。

但目前 SCSI 驅動程式 ssd 僅支援至多 2 TB 的磁碟。如果您需要 2 TB 以上的磁碟容量,請使用磁碟及儲存管理產品 (如 Solaris Volume Manager) 來建立較大的裝置。

如需有關使用 EFI 磁碟標籤的更多資訊,請參閱「System Administration Guide: Devices and File Systems」。此指南包含重要資訊和限制說明。此資訊涉及有關 EFI 磁碟標籤與現有軟體產品配合使用的內容。

在本版 Solaris 中,亦可使用 Solaris Volume Manager 軟體管理大於 1 TB 的磁碟。請參閱Solaris Volume Manager 中的多 TB 磁碟區支援

Autofs 環境的新配置檔

這是 Software Express 試驗程式中的新增功能。Solaris 10 3/05 發行版本中有此功能。

供您的 autofs 環境使用的新配置檔 /etc/default/autofs,為您的 autofs 指令及 autofs 常駐程式提供另一種配置方法。現在,您可以使用新配置檔產生您使用指令行所產生的相同規格。但是,與使用指令行產生規格不同的是,在升級您的作業系統期間,此檔案會保留您的規格。此外,您不再需要更新重要的啟動檔案,以保留您的 autofs 環境的現有運作方式。

您可以使用下列關鍵字來產生您的規格:

如需更多資訊,請參閱「automount(1M)線上手冊」和「automountd(1M)線上手冊」。

如需進一步資訊,請參閱「System Administration Guide: Network Services」